Project Details

This project would build upon a collaboration between these two groups to better understand and manage autoinflammatory diseases (AIDs) that dates back to 2005 and has resulted in numerous high-impact publications. Potential projects include biomarker discovery/validation, analysis of monocyte-to-macrophage differentiation defects in AID patients, novel genomic analyses of a uniquely large cohort, dissecting the heterogeneity of interferon-mediated AIDs, etc. Students would avail themselves of world-class resources, novel translational assays, and unique patient populations of the Translational Autoinflammatory Diseases section at NIAID, and the Immune Dysregulation Frontiers Program at The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ia.
